| Symptom | Possible Cause | Corrective Action |
|---|---|---|
| Washer won't start | Power supply issue | Check power connection and outlet. |
| No water filling | Hoses kinked or blocked | Check hoses for kinks and ensure water supply is on. |
| Excessive vibration | Unbalanced load | Redistribute laundry evenly in the drum. |
| Door won't open | Cycle not complete | Wait for cycle to finish; check for error codes. |
